I'm looking into getting a set of 20's and 33's on my 2004 Screw. However, I'm not an expert on the meanings of the wheel offsets and such. The 20 that I am looking at is a 20x8.5 with a +40 offset. I'm looking at getting the new IROK 33/13.50 (getting leveling kit put on as we speak). First off, will there be any rubbing with this wheel and tire combo? Secondly, how far would the tires stick out?
It all depends if you have a 4x4 or 4x2. 4x4's sit higher and will prob fit 33's, if it's 4x2 you will have to lift it. Mine is a 4x2 and i had to put a 3.5in spindle lift on and do alot of trimming to fit my 20's and 33in nitto terra grapplers. my 33's are 12.5in wide and therefore caused even more trouble to clear the front valence when turning. I'm about to put another 1 1/2 to 2in daystar lift on to help clear on bumps in turns. I also have the old 2001 model, but yours is close to it.

Also be aware when you go to 20's, your larger tire selection drops quite a bit, make sure you find some tires you like before you buy your rims! Best bet get a package.
